Semiotics- Image Analysis

We were given an image which had no brand identification on and told to analyse the image through cultural reference, decades, key words and the brands that the image could possibly be linked to due to the analysis.
Cultural References/Decades
Madonna-Diamonds are a Girls Best Friend- 80's
Marilyn Manroe- 50's
Early Hollywood Glamour
Elizabethan Era
90's hair
Pretty in Pink film

Key words
Romantic, Soft, Sensual, Pretty, Girly, Sophisticated, Elegant, Sexual, Desirable

Brands
D&G
Chanel 
Dior
